Know Your Rights

Every person, regardless of their immigration status, has rights. Understanding these rights is the first step in protecting yourself, your loved ones, and your community. Whether you’re at home, at work, or in public, knowing what to do in critical moments can make all the difference.

In today’s climate, immigrants are often targeted with fear tactics and misinformation. Equipping yourself with the facts not only helps you navigate potentially harmful encounters but also builds resilience within your family and strengthens the broader community.

Knowledge is Power

When you know your rights, you are empowered to:

  • Safeguard your home and workplace
  • Advocate for your family’s well-being
  • Hold systems accountable
